A remote controlled undersea vehicle detects debris from a sunken craft at a rate of 60 pieces per hour. The time to detect debris can be modeled using an exponential distribution.
a) What is the probability that the time to detect the next piece of debris is less than 2 minutes? (hint: the rate λ needs to be in the same units as the random variable)
b) What is the probability that the time to detect the next pieces of debris is between 2.5 and 4.5 minutes?
c) What is the median time to detection of debris?
